Argentina: Cotton Exports Jump 200%

Significant rise in the export of cotton has been registered by Argentina last year. For 2005, cotton exports stood at 129,768,480 pound bales recording a massive 200 percent increase, year on year basis and the highest since 2001.

Argentine cotton finds favor with Chile's denim fabric producers who patronize it in a big way.

Chile also emerged as top destination for Argentine cotton with purchase of 42,696,480 pound bales.

Thailand, Turkey, Vietnam and Taiwan were other leading destinations for Argentine cotton, statistics reveal.
